Angmering station offers a range of facilities designed to make your travel experience comfortable. The station is equipped with a ticket office and machines that are accessible for all users, including those with disabilities. Ticket purchasing and collection is straightforward, with machines available that accept online ticket collections as well. Smartcards can be both issued and validated at this station, offering a convenient alternative for frequent travelers.
For those seeking assistance, help is readily available. There are both ticket office staff and help points to provide information and aid, ensuring that all travelers are supported throughout their journey. Travelers can rest easy knowing that the station is under CCTV surveillance for added safety. It is worth noting, however, that while Angmering station features toilets, the absence of accessible toilets can be a limitation for some passengers.
Angmering station is not just about rail travel—it also connects you to other transport modes. There are local bus services available for onward travel within the town and to neighboring areas, providing flexibility in your travel plans. Those requiring detailed information can refer to the Onward Travel Information Map available at the station. While there are no dedicated accessible taxis on-site, the area in front of the station is spacious enough to facilitate pickups and drop-offs for those with mobility impairments.

For those looking to purchase or collect tickets, the ticket office is open from 6:00 AM to 11:00 PM every day, including weekends, and there are accessible ticket machines for your convenience. The station also offers step-free access throughout the premises, ensuring that passengers with limited mobility can travel with ease. Additionally, CCTV cameras are in operation to ensure your safety and security.
While you wait for your train, you’re welcome to use the public toilets, which are available from 4:00 AM to 11:00 PM daily, and the accessible bathrooms feature baby changing facilities. Although there are no designated waiting rooms or seating areas, the station is equipped with a help point and staff assistance is available at any time should you need it.
When it comes to onward travel, Southend Airport train station does not disappoint. If you're planning to explore London, you can catch a train to London Liverpool Street or Stratford (London). Prefer to stay local? Head to Southend Victoria, a central location perfect for exploring the seaside town. For those venturing further afield, there are trains to Chelmsford and Colchester, offering a pleasant blend of urban and rural experiences.
If you're in need of a cab, the information for taxis can be found through Northern Railway's Cab4You service. Bus services are also readily accessible, providing ample options to connect with local areas.
